How they compare

China, Hong Kong SAR currently reports 46.5 kg/ha against 43.61 kg/ha in Bangladesh, a difference of 2.89 kg/ha.

That makes China, Hong Kong SAR's figure about 1.1 times Bangladesh's.

The two have swapped places 8 times across 63 shared years of data; in 1961 it was China, Hong Kong SAR ahead.

Bangladesh ranks 31st and China, Hong Kong SAR ranks 28th of 186 countries.

Across the 7 decades both report, Bangladesh averaged higher in 2 and China, Hong Kong SAR in 5.

Head to head by decade

Decade Bangladesh China, Hong Kong SAR Difference Ahead
1960s 10.22 kg/ha 41.37 kg/ha 31.15 kg/ha China, Hong Kong SAR
1970s 11.26 kg/ha 55.67 kg/ha 44.41 kg/ha China, Hong Kong SAR
1980s 13.59 kg/ha 61.58 kg/ha 47.99 kg/ha China, Hong Kong SAR
1990s 16.93 kg/ha 38.99 kg/ha 22.06 kg/ha China, Hong Kong SAR
2000s 25.04 kg/ha 24.45 kg/ha 0.5862 kg/ha Bangladesh
2010s 36.53 kg/ha 33.29 kg/ha 3.24 kg/ha Bangladesh
2020s 41.7 kg/ha 46.39 kg/ha 4.69 kg/ha China, Hong Kong SAR

Averages of every year both report within each decade.

The Cropland Nutrient balance domain contains information on the flows of nitrogen, phosphorus, and potassium from mineral fertilizer, manure applied, atmospheric deposition, crop removal, and biological fixation over cropland and per unit area of cropland. The flows are aggregated to total inputs and total outputs, from which the overall nutrient balance and nutrient use efficiency on cropland are calculated. Statistics are disseminated in units of tonnes and in kg/ha, as appropriate. Nutrient use efficiency is expressed as a fraction (%).
